I just recharged my ac and it worked and then

I had recharged it about 2 months ago and it worked until now. so I just recharged my ac again and it worked and then later that afternoon it was still working and then all of a sudden hot air came out and ever since then the ac has not worked

Someone please help? I have a 2005 chrysler 300 touring and when we bought the car 4 months ago the heater would work just the ac, and just the other night the ac broke or just stopped working

The A/C can be read with a scanner. But just a guess. The heat didn't work for maybe three reasons, first the heater core is plugged up, second someone bypassed it because it was leaking on the inside, third the blend door motor is bad, stuck on A/C.
The A/C could be low on freon, again. Most places put die in the system to check for leaks. Takes a black light to see the die, unless it was used in excess. You will need to recharge it to see if it is the problem. If you do it yourself, use at least one can of freon with die in it. If it happens again, you or someone can find the leak.

My 03 Nissan Altima's ac is blowing hot. I recharged it and 2 months later it blows hot again.

Did you ever think, that it was leaking refrigerant in the first place, and polluting the atmosphere.
If you need to recharge it,you must by federal law,recover the existing freon,repair the leaks,pull a vacuum,test that the system holds,then recharge.
You need to get this done professionally, by a shop equipped and trained to work on A/C

Ac seems to work great untill you accelerate,then you can hear the fan motor slow down, cold air stops. when acceleration is decreased seems to start up again. long trips are great except for the uphill...

Have the alternator checked,with the ac on high,and the headlights on,it should read 13.65 volts,to 14.25 volts,checked at the battery,if it is lower than this,replace the alternator,now if the alternator checks out good,have the compressor coil clutch replaced,it will be shorting out,.
